It has been announced that a new game in the “Pokémon” series, “Pokémon LEGENDS”, will be released for the Nintendo Switch family of systems in 2025. On February 27th (US time)Short trailer videoannounced in「Pokémon LEGENDS Z-A」is an “ambitious new addition” to the Pokémon LEGENDS series, and will be released simultaneously worldwide. In addition, excitement is growing as the successor to the Nintendo Switch is expected to be released next year.

The first work in the series, “Pokémon LEGENDS Arceus”, was released in 2022. Pokémon LEGENDS Arceus, the first open-world game in the series, broke new ground for Pokémon LEGENDS and was long-awaited by fans.

Pokémon LEGENDS ZA is set in Miare City in the Kalos region (a French-style town that was the setting for Pokémon X and Y), but the Pokémon Company has revealed few details about ZA. Pokémon LEGENDS ZA says, “An urban redevelopment plan for Miare City is underway with the aim of creating a city where people and Pokémon coexist.”

When will “Nintendo Switch 2” be announced?

Expectations for Nintendo’s new game console are extremely high. It’s been about seven years since Nintendo released the first Nintendo Switch, and more than two years since the organic EL model was released. That’s why fans are speculating when the next system will arrive.

The existence of a successor to the Nintendo Switch has recently become an open secret. In the 2024 State of the Industry Survey conducted by organizers of the Game Developers Conference (GDC), 8% of developers surveyed said they were working on developing games for successor consoles.

It doesn’t matter whether “Nintendo Switch 2” exists or not. The question is when Nintendo will announce it.
